DIY Cabling – New ACMA Regulations

ACMA LogoWednesday 23rd July 2014

In years gone by general ‘computer network cabling’ was exempt from the various rules and regulations that applied to telecommunications cabling.

As of 1st July 2014 the regulations set by the Australian Communications and Media Authority (ACMA – a Federal Govt Authority) require that technicians who are installing computer network cabling to be registered, after satisfactorily completing the appropriate training course.

Aside from the obvious network performance issues, the new regulations specify safety aspects of cabling installations, including the separation of power from data cabling.
